Earlsboro crime statistics report an overall downward trend in crime based on data from 2 years with violent crime decreasing and property crime decreasing. Based on this trend, the crime rate in Earlsboro for 2025 is expected to be lower than in 2018.
The city violent crime rate for Earlsboro in 2018 was lower than the
national violent crime rate average by 18.77% and the city property crime rate in Earlsboro was lower than the
national property crime rate average by 71.89%.
In 2018 the city violent crime rate in Earlsboro was lower than the
violent crime rate in Oklahoma by 33.68% and the city property crime rate in Earlsboro was lower than the
property crime rate in Oklahoma by 78.5%.
